This study reports for the first time on the occurrences of deep-water coral species in the Spanish territorial waters of the Strait of Gibraltar. Based on an extensive dataset of 334 grab samples, 16 species of calcareous corals have been identified in water depths between 13–443 m. The Jáchal River Valley displays a number of significant Holocene sedimentary accumulations made up of fine-grained materials. These deposits are interpreted as the sedimentary infill of shallow temporary lakes that were generated by slow growing episodes of alluvial fans that obstructed the Jáchal River Valley. The Eocene (Bartonian) marls of the La Guixa Member and Gurb Member, Vic Marls Formation (Ebro Basin, Catalonia, Spain), contain a very rich and diversified siliceous sponge fauna. The fauna is dominated by hexactinellids; lithistids and other demosponges are rare. It consists of 16 species representing 16 genera. A correlation between the charophyte index-species Raskyella peckii and the biozonation of larger foraminifera (Shallow Benthic Zones SBZ 13 and SBZ 18) is proposed, which results in a widening to about 6 MA of the present known chronostratigraphic range of the charophyte species.
